Thoroughbreds: Can McMudder keep his winning ways going Tuesday at Parx?

It’s a beautiful day for racing. Post time 12:55 pm.

Fast and the winds have subsided. The last few days have been all about handicapping to track bias with the rains and winds. Today should get back to seeing the track play more fair across the entire fields and that usually means a return to more chalk. Therefore, today’s entire focus is on bringing in one or two longshots so you get some return on your investment.

Parx Race 1
Maidens at this level are always tough and the fact that much of the field has been at this for a while makes it all the more difficult. 6-Royal Melbourne is the pick here as he seems to have finally woken up out of a long sleep. The last race was pretty good and Dexter Haddock, who seems to get the best from this one, climbs on board again. The low percentage barn and the advanced age will keep punters away but in this field, he is the most progressive. 3-Trust the Process stands a chance to be greatly improved after the long layoff and change of trainers but this one may need a race or two. Throw the favorite, 5-Ami’s Artie into the exotics for some coverage since the turf try last out is a throw away race.

Parx Race 2
Not much separates these and the right angle is to go to the dropper with the longest odds. On the M/L that is 6-Congressional Storm who comes in here off of decent efforts at higher levels and won at twice this level 4 back. Her price should come down but the 9-year-old will keep many punters away. The key will be to get first run at 3-Bon Heir who appears to be the speed here. If speed holds in the first, look for these two to be 1-2 in the second.
